Designed by
Title
MOSCOW, MAY, 13, 2018: Russian police man in bulletproof vest at metro railway station Komsomolskaya with people in the background #116912563
Description
MOSCOW, MAY, 13, 2018: Russian police man in bulletproof vest at metro railway station Komsomolskaya with people in the background. Police securing people and subway property
This image is editorial